Transaction ea509875113f421a0c41881a79aeba164fce6853e9e10eb9f8a891ecca34988f
1 Input
1 Output
-
ea509875113f421a0c41881a79aeba164fce6853e9e10eb9f8a891ecca34988f:0
- value
- 581675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d684cb2ca980677cac1194bc6fe369d3c49f372 OP_EQUAL
- address
- 3BfWXKKmn2nMDdUGenD6iezPT7CHioMgno